## Summary

Ofcom is exploring spectrum monitoring solutions to shape its future monitoring capability, spectrum monitoring strategy and systems review, investment cases and later procurement. The requirement is for modern telecommunications equipment, software and supporting maintenance services, rather than a like-for-like replacement of existing assets. Expected capabilities include software-based monitoring platforms, remote operation, automated alerting, spectrum data storage and retrieval, direction-finding integration, and analytics. The solutions should support Ofcom’s current operational work and future evidence-led spectrum management. Delivery is intended across the United Kingdom. The buying organisation is Ofcom, a UK public authority. This is primarily a technology and telecommunications systems requirement, with associated equipment maintenance and supporting services. The engagement is intended to test the market’s available approaches and suppliers’ ability to deliver an integrated future monitoring capability.

This procurement is at the planning stage and is currently a preliminary market engagement, not an invitation to tender. Ofcom expects to use market feedback to inform its procurement strategy, future strategic options, investment cases and procurement considerations. The engagement is conducted through a questionnaire, with possible follow-up discussions; completed questionnaires are expected by 12 noon on 18 September 2026. Ofcom currently expects a subsequent notice around June 2027. The planned procurement has one lot and an estimated gross value of £5,000,000. The anticipated contract period is 1 June 2028 to 31 May 2033. The requirement is above the applicable threshold. Ofcom has indicated that the future procurement will be treated as not particularly suited to SMEs or VCSEs, although market input from those organisations is welcome during this engagement.

## Notice

Ofcom is undertaking this market engagement to understand how available spectrum monitoring systems, software and supporting services could help define and deliver Ofcom's future monitoring capability. This will inform the ongoing Spectrum Monitoring Strategy and Systems Review, future strategic options, potential investment cases and future procurement considerations. The focus of this engagement is therefore not simply replacement of existing equipment on a like-for-like basis. Ofcom is seeking to understand the market for modern spectrum monitoring capability, including software-based monitoring platforms, remote operation, automated alerting, spectrum data storage and retrieval, direction-finding integration, analytics, and options that could support both current operational work and future evidence-led spectrum management.
